I tried installing Porteus Kiosk 4.8.0 on a "all-in-one-client" from a USB device, but when booting from USB, Errors are shown and the installation never reaches the point, where you can choose, what type of connection (wired, wlan, etc) you want to use.

My problem at the moment is, that those errors are shown less then a second on screen and disappear. Bios log shows nothing, unfortunately. Is there a way to write those errors to a file or make them wait for a button press, etc? Or is the server logging boot errors, if I try it via PXE?

Without the errors, helping me will be almost impossible I guess, but If anyone has experienced a similar error or if I overlook something obvious, I will explain, what workarounds I tried:

First try was on a 2 TB USB harddrive, USB 2.0. (Overkill, but I had no USB Stick at the moment). I downloaded the .iso file (Porteus Kiosk) and made the device bootable with win32diskimager and rufus (in dd mode). I tried mbr, as well as gpt and used FAT32. I suspected a problem with the size of the device, so I got a 32 USB Stick with USB 3.0 and tried all the configurations from before with the same results.
In BIOS, I disabled all virtual CPU functions and all devices (webcam, speakers, etc) but no success.

Hello Sebowski,

1) Please boot Ubuntu live on this PC, if it boots ok then download and run this script:
https://porteus-kiosk.org/public/files/debug.sh

Code: Select all

sudo bash debug.sh
Then send generated report to support@porteus-kiosk.org.

2) Please also provide video how you boot the kiosk - maybe i'll be able to spot the error.
